React Router 是 React.js 中用于页面路由管理的一个库。它允许你在单页应用中管理多个视图,而不需要重新加载页面。

功能特性

  • 声明式路由:通过配置式定义路由,使页面跳转更加直观和简洁。
  • 嵌套路由:支持在子组件中嵌套路由,实现复杂的应用结构。
  • 动态路由:可以根据 URL 参数动态渲染组件。

快速开始

首先,你需要在项目中安装 React Router:

npm install react-router-dom

然后,在你的应用中引入 BrowserRouterRoute 组件:

import { BrowserRouter as Router, Route } from 'react-router-dom';

function App() {
  return (
    <Router>
      <div>
        <Route path="/" exact component={Home} />
        <Route path="/about" component={About} />
      </div>
    </Router>
  );
}

在上面的例子中,HomeAbout 是两个简单的组件。

更多内容

想要了解更多关于 React Router 的知识,可以访问本站提供的 React Router 教程

React_Router